Detailed Examples for Addition Drill Mock Paper
Let’s dive into detailed examples to illustrate the Addition Drill Mock Paper process. First example: Add 123 + 456. On the abacus, set 123 on the right rods: 3 on units, 2 on tens, 1 on hundreds. Add 456: add 6 to units (3+6=9), 5 to tens (2+5=7), 4 to hundreds (1+4=5). Result: 579. Common mistake: forgetting carry-over if sums exceed 9. Tip: Always check bead positions. Second example: 278 + 349. Set 278, add 349: units 8+9=17 (carry 1, set 7), tens 7+4+1=12 (carry 1, set 2), hundreds 2+3+1=6. Result: 627. Mistake: Incorrect carry. Tip: Verbalize steps. Third example: 512 + 487. Set 512, add 487: units 2+7=9, tens 1+8=9, hundreds 5+4=9. Result: 999. Mistake: Rushing without verification. Tip: Double-check with mental math. These examples highlight precision needed in exams.
Basic Concepts Required
Basic concepts for the Addition Drill Mock Paper include understanding abacus structure: rods represent place values, beads for units (1-4 lower, 5 upper). Addition involves moving beads right to left, handling carry-overs when sums hit 10 or more. Know complements: for 5, use upper bead. Practice finger movements for efficiency. Grasp place values up to thousands. These fundamentals ensure accurate computations in timed settings. Without them, advanced drills become challenging.

The Logic Behind Abacus Calculations
The logic behind abacus calculations lies in its decimal representation. Each rod is a power of 10, beads quantify values. Addition merges quantities rod by rod, carrying excesses. This visual-tactile method reinforces number sense better than rote memorization. It encourages understanding over calculation, reducing errors.
